Explore ‘best practices’ of how ODR can be effectively deployed as an option to Face-to-Face interactions. Topics to be reviewed: - What is Online Dispute Resolution? - How/when to use audio or video conferencing? Are there other software or hardware aspects to consider? - Should email/texting/chat be offered to participants? If so, how? - Setting up an ODR session - How to preserve Confidentiality throughout the process? - How to manage? - If a technical glitch occurs – what to do? Instantly reconvene? Reschedule?
